Memory phrase for the character: 址
址
Hanzi-Trainer
Meaning
address, location, site
Pronunciation
zhǐ
Explanation
Left: earth 土, right: to stop 止 (footprint of a right foot that stops at a line 一)
Mnemonic
Show English
The 'earth' where I stop, is my address.
Radicals
土
earth, ground Pay attention to the length of the upper line. If it is longer, it means scholar 士.
止
stop, to end At top the picture of a left foot and at bottom a limiting line. "The foot stands at the line 一 and stops."
